Nearly half of the projects awarded under the re-launch of South Africa's renewable power purchase programme have failed, two government sources told Reuters, undermining plans to use wind and solar to ease the nation's power crisis.
Regular breakdowns at state power utility Eskom's ageing coal-fired plants mean the continent's most developed economy faces daily planned power cuts. President Cyril Ramaphosa has said the country needs to fill a 4,000 to 6,000-megawatt electricity production deficit.
But he said the government now expects only half of the 2,583 MW in capacity anticipated following the auction to come online. "The problem with bid window five was that we put all our eggs in one basket," the second official said. "You can't do at such low tariffs. It's stupid."Both sources asked not to be named as they were not authorised to comment publicly on the matter.
Responding to Reuters questions, Ikamva said higher interest rates, the increased cost of energy and other commodities, as well as the slower production of equipment post-pandemic had impacted its calculations.
